Job description

Company: MMC Corporate

Description:

We are looking for talented and motivated candidates based in Warsaw for the position of:

Accounting and Reporting Specialist
(Captive Operations Group)

What can you expect?

In the Captive Operations Group, we handle accounting, regulatory compliance, and administrative functions for a portfolio of captive insurance companies and other clients.

What’s in it for you:

  • Daily project work with international stakeholders (mainly EMEA and Middle East regions)
  • Working with IFRS and local GAAP daily
  • Company-sponsored postgraduate ACCA studies
  • Flexible working hours
  • Team-building events
  • Attractive benefits (private healthcare, sports card, life insurance, lunch card, language courses)

We will count on you to:

  • Perform various accounting activities such as cash and investment account reconciliations, bank deposits, cash disbursements, intercompany reconciliations, asset valuations, and claims activity tracking
  • Prepare financial statements for mid-sized clients based on IFRS
  • Plan and execute annual audits for clients
  • Prepare regulatory filings
  • Ensure ongoing compliance with domicile insurance regulations
  • Maintain client and office databases
  • Investigate outstanding issues on client accounts and communicate with clients as needed

What you need to have:

  • At least 3 years of professional experience in finance or auditing
  • MA or BA degree in Finance, Accounting, or Economics
  • Excellent command of English (minimum B2)
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office, especially Excel (formulas and data analysis)
  • Strong organizational and prioritization skills with attention to detail
  • Excellent interpersonal and communication skills
  • Critical thinking and problem-solving abilities
  • An open mindset towards change and continuous improvement

What makes you stand out:

  • Prior accounting experience in an accounting firm, insurance company, or FSI audit
  • ACCA/CIMA/CPA qualification or part-qualified

Marsh, a business of Marsh McLennan (NYSE: MMC), is the world’s leading insurance broker and risk advisor. Marsh McLennan is a global leader in risk, strategy, and people, advising clients in 130 countries across four businesses: Marsh, Guy Carpenter, Mercer, and Oliver Wyman. With annual revenue of $24 billion and over 90,000 employees, Marsh McLennan helps build confidence to thrive through the power of perspective.
